SureStay by Best Western Columbus Downtown is a hotel located at Address: 1024 Veterans Pkwy #1034, Columbus, GA 31901. You can contact them at Phone: 064302114. More information about the hotel can be found on their website: bestwestern.com.

This hotel specializes in providing a comfortable and enjoyable stay for its guests. They offer a variety of amenities, including a fitness center, business center, and free Wi-Fi. The hotel's location in downtown Columbus makes it convenient for guests to access local attractions, such as the National Infantry Museum and the Coca-Cola Space Science Center.

SureStay by Best Western Columbus Downtown has received 95 reviews on Google My Business, with an average opinion of 3.5/5. Many guests have praised the hotel for its cleanliness, comfortable beds, and friendly staff. However, some have noted issues with noise and the quality of the breakfast.
